Supply Chain Finance LF HW Analyst

Description -

Job Summary

  • This is a WW Supply Chain Finance Analyst role based in Penang, Malaysia supporting Source and Factory Operations for Large Format Hardware business. Other than key financial cadence of Budget, Forecast, MEC, ESC setting, variance analysis & compliance related vigilance, this role partners closely with Operations team to drive cost savings opportunities and optimize cash. The analyst is also expected to strive for optimal efficiency through continuous process improvement leveraging effective digital tools.

Responsibilities

  • Performs complex financial analysis for specific functions or business units, identifies issues and recommends solutions.
  • Conducts comprehensive financial analysis for specific functions or business units, providing valuable analytics to support key business initiatives.
  • Participates in cross-functional teams as a representative of the finance domain.
  • Establishes and maintains relationships with business leaders to guide and influence decision-making.
  • Supports policy and process enhancement, identifying opportunities for improved efficiency and organizational growth.
  • Drives the forecasting process (weekly, monthly, and long term) by analyzing trends within the businesses and ensuring alignment with overall business objectives.
  • Provides information and counsel in the areas of controls, budgeting, and planning, return on investment decisions, and the development of overall business plans and strategies.
  • Solves difficult and complex problems with a fresh perspective, demonstrating good judgment in selecting creative solutions and managing projects independently.
  • Leads moderate to high complexity projects, delivering professionally written reports, and supports the realization of operational and strategic plans.
  • Provides mentoring and guidance to lower-level roles, thereby aiming to enhance individual as well as organizational performance.

Education & Experience Recommended

  • Four-year or Graduate Degree in Business Administration, Economics, Finance, or any other related discipline or commensurate work experience or demonstrated competence.
  • Typically has 4-7 years of work experience, preferably in financial management, internal audit, accounting, or a related field or an advanced degree with 3-5 years of work experience.
